Transportation UET Lahore Launches New Afternoon Bus Service for Students

The University of Engineering and Technology (UET) Lahore has launched a new afternoon bus service to address student demand for better transportation after classes. This initiative, directed by Vice Chancellor Prof. Dr. Shahid Munir (TI), expands commuting options for students engaged in extracurriculars, laboratory work, and other activities later in the day.

The expanded routes encompass existing destinations within the university’s transportation network. This ensures convenient travel for students returning home after academic commitments. The UET Lahore Transport Office has publicized detailed schedules and route maps via official channels, including notice boards and the university website.

This service is anticipated to significantly benefit daytime students, alleviating transportation difficulties. Vice Chancellor Prof. Dr. Shahid Munir (TI) commended the Transport Department”s efforts, reaffirming UET”s dedication to a supportive learning atmosphere and comprehensive student resources.
